Hollywood Beach Elementary is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Oxnard, Ventura County. The school has 282 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Monica Shallenberger. It is part of the Hueneme Elementary school district. It serves grades Kโ6 in a suburban setting. The school employs 14.2 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 19.9:1.

By race and ethnicity, the student body is 44% White, 38% Hispanic or Latino and 11% Two or more races.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| White | 123 | 44%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 106 | 38% |
| Two or more races | 31 | 11% |
| Asian | 15 | 5.3% |
| Black or African American | 7 | 2.5%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
91 of the school's 282 students (32%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Hollywood Beach Elementary is located in a suburban setting (NCES locale: Suburb, Large).
Hollywood Beach Elementary is one of 11 schools in Hueneme Elementary, based in Port Hueneme, California. The district serves 6,685 students district-wide and employs 332 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 282 students, Hollywood Beach Elementary is smaller than the district average of about 608 students per school.
